Thunder Add Defenseman Donnie Harris to Mix

October 20, 2015 - ECHL (ECHL)
Wichita Thunder News Release


Wichita, KS (Oct. 20th) - The Wichita Thunder, proud member of the ECHL and powered by Toyota, announced today that the team has signed defenseman Donnie Harris and placed him on reserve. To make room, the team has released blueliner Andrew Darrigo.

Harris, 24, has spent the last three seasons as a member of the Evansville IceMen. A native of Ashby, West Virginia, Harris appeared in 145 games for Evansville, recording 20 points (4g, 16a).

Known as a stay-at-home defenseman, the 6-foot-3, 225-pound blueliner has also spent time with the Elmira Jackals and the Pensacola Ice Flyers of the SPHL. Prior to turning pro, he won a junior hockey championship with the Omaha Lancers of the USHL in 2007-08.
